SEO

Settings interface with automation type and prompt options.

Parse out names, addresses, complex fields using AI


We've had several clients working with memberships, who have a single name field with the full name of a person. And then they ask us to build a directory that is sorted by last name. This is a bit hard to do if there's a first name in front of it!

Names don't follow rules very well. Some have apostrophes in them, some have multiple words -- you can't just take the last word of a name and assume that's the last name, because often it just isn't.

Read More
Flowchart diagram with labeled boxes and arrows, illustrating a process model.

Control access to particular pages, fields


Drupal has long had a variety of access control modules, to make it so you can easily control who can view or edit particular pages. There are actually several different layers of APIs to control this in Drupal core -- the modules generally provide a user interface to let you control access by content type, by tagging content with particular terms, through their position on a menu, or through a group. The Field Permissions module lets you control access to particular fields on an entity.

Read More

Price Card

 Hourly rates - For Profit customers

ItemNotesRate
Monthly RetainerHigher priority on our calendar, best rates.

Action

Freelock provides a broad range of support services to help you get the most from your website. Whether you need a quick graphic, help making your website accessible, or an entirely new system for taking orders, reservations, or communicating your message, Freelock can provide a suitable plan with a variety of payment agreements.

 

Protection

Freelock's Protection Plan covers the baseline that everyone needs -- keeping your site safe. Every month there can be dozens of updates to the code that powers your WordPress or Drupal site. Some of these may fix critical vulnerabilities, while others introduce minor bug fixes and changes that if left unapplied, can accumulate to bigger disruption if you need to apply a bunch at once.

Freelock Guarantee Terms and Conditions

The guarantee is that if something we developed or implemented breaks within the first year, we will fix it at no extra charge. This does cover items specified during the course of the project that might have been overlooked. It does not cover functionality that is not specified or out of scope. And it does depend on us applying regular updates to WordPress core and plugins (in fact, that's the main thing that might cause something to break -- a change in a plugin that changes how any custom code we write operates).

Website Security Audit

Our data-driven and interconnected world has created a lot of opportunities. It has created many luxuries that have made our lives and businesses better. In all likelihood, we’re likely to see more interconnections and further benefits to society and business as data becomes even more widespread. Providing us with the data that we need to make informed decisions is a good thing, and it should be commended. Unfortunately, it should also be protected. There are many that could stand to gain from gaining access to data illicitly.

How many new customers has your website found for you?

While there are many ways to grow a business in today’s society—one path has shown to be more-effective than others. This approach has quickly grown some companies, while others have not found their footing. This approach uses the new technologies to their most-effective. If done correctly, these tools can grow a company without spending any of the company’s money. This approach is called “Content Marketing”.